Sticky Rice Rolls aka Fàn Tuán is a popular and inexpensive breakfast sold by street vendors in Taiwan. With it's warm sticky rice and customizable fillings, this grab and go meal is not only satisfying but tasty. The ingredients needed to make Sticky rice roll:
  1. Take 1 cup sticky rice
  2. Get 1 can tuna fish or 1 medium fresh piece
  3. Prepare 1 big onion sliced
  4. Get 1 tsp ginger-garlic paste
  5. Take 1 chopped green chilli
  6. Take 1 small tomato chopped
  7. Take 1/2 small capsicum chopped(optional)
  8. Get 1 small eggplant chopped (optional)
  9. Prepare 1/4 th tsp turmeric powder
  10. Take 1/2 tsp red chilli powder
  11. Make ready Salt as per taste
  12. Take 1 tbsp cooking oil
  13. Prepare 1 tbsp black and white sesame seeds

Instructions to make Sticky rice roll:
  1. Wash and soak sticky rice for 2 hours
  2. In a pressure cooker put the soaked rice. Put water just upto rice level.
  3. Pressure cook it in low flame for 15 to 20 minutes.
  4. Remove from heat, open the lid and keep aside to cool.
  5. Heat oil in a pan,add onion. Saute till translucent. Add ginger-garlic paste and chopped chilli. Saute.
  6. Add chopped tomato and other veggies if you have.
  7. Fry for 2/3 minutes. Add turmeric powder,red chilli powder and salt. Saute for a minute.
  8. Add shredded tuna (if you use fresh fish then first shallow fry in another pan, then shred it).
  9. Mix all the ingredients with a spatula. Cover and cook in low heat for 5 minutes.
  10. Stuffing is ready now.
  11. For making the roll first spread a banana leaf or cling film in a clean counter top.
  12. Spread some black and white sesame seeds.
  13. Spread the sticky rice in rectangular shape. Press rice with greased hand to make the shape nice and uniform.
  14. Now spread some fish filling in one side of the rectangle length wise.
  15. Now hold the banana leaf or cling film and roll the sheet to make a log.
  16. Press to make the log firm.
  17. Now slowly remove the leaf/cling film slowly.
  18. Cut this log with a greased knife into desired lengh.
  19. Now these sticky rice rolls are ready to enjoy.
